Post Harvest Potency Retention

Post-harvest potency retention refers to a cannabis strain's capacity to maintain cannabinoid and terpene profiles after drying, curing, and storage. Environmental factors—including temperature, humidity, light exposure, and oxygen—significantly influence how quickly cannabinoids degrade or convert over time. Strains with robust cell wall structure and dense trichome architecture often demonstrate stronger retention profiles. Breeders working in preservation-focused genetics select parent plants showing minimal cannabinoid loss during controlled aging trials. This classification is particularly relevant for seed banks, commercial cultivators, and breeding programs prioritizing genetic stability across harvest cycles.

Breeder relevance

Breeders assess post-harvest retention by comparing fresh-harvest cannabinoid profiles against stored samples at standardized intervals. Selecting parent plants with superior retention traits helps ensure final products maintain labeled potency longer, supporting both seed-line consistency and commercial shelf-life reliability.
